Past Experience
With 10 years of planning commission service, I have a proven record of guiding zoning amendments and developing forward-thinking ordinances to foster smart, sustainable growth in the Village of Empire. I have played a key role in crafting community-driven master plans that reflect residents' visions and priorities, ensuring that development aligns with long term goals. My background in business will balance economic opportunity with thoughtful planning, positioning me to effectively address Traverse City's current and future growth challenges. I am committed to leveraging my expertise and collaborative leadership to achieve balanced, well-managed development for the community.
My Top Issues
Balance development with neighborhood preservation
Balanced development in Traverse City requires thoughtful planning that supports growth while preserving the unique character of our neighborhoods. By encouraging responsible investment and respecting the values of long-time residents, we can ensure that new projects enhance rather than disrupt the community. Protecting neighborhood identity while accommodating progress is key to maintaining Traverse City’s appeal for both current and future generations.
Attracting and retaining businesses
Expanding job opportunities outside the tourism sector—such as in technology, light manufacturing, and professional services—can create a more stable, year-round economy. By prioritizing industries that offer higher-paying jobs and long-term stability, Traverse City can build a more resilient economy that benefits residents year-round.
Investing in park maintenance and improvement
As a Michigan native who grew up in a city celebrated for its parks and recreation, I understand firsthand the value of quality public spaces in shaping a community. Now, as a father of seven, I am deeply motivated to enhance and protect our parks so that my children—and all children in our community—can experience the same vibrant, active childhood that I enjoyed. My experiences fuel my commitment to investing in safe, accessible, and welcoming parks for families today and for generations to come.

The GoodParty.org Pledge
All candidates empowered by GoodParty.org agree to the following:
Independent
Candidates are running outside the two-party system as an Independent, nonpartisan, or third-party candidate.
People-Powered
Candidates take the majority of their funds from grassroots donors and reject the influence of special interests and big money.
Anti-Corruption
Candidates pledge to be accountable and transparent with their policy agendas and report attempts to unduly influence them.
Civility
Candidates pledge to run a clean campaign free of mudslinging and uphold a minimum standard of civility in their campaign's conduct.
